Output 0744d716f59620685fd8a2dbe206730b5cb49e89dd14838e1c93c5a59d853632:0

value
787272
script pubkey
OP_HASH160 OP_PUSHBYTES_20 680c7e2e79992c07b41dee285442463bfa2a2dd3 OP_EQUAL
address
3BBBAWsPK33MwWossAyQ8kykt9n4h86ugN
transaction
0744d716f59620685fd8a2dbe206730b5cb49e89dd14838e1c93c5a59d853632
confirmations
297519
spent
true